Output dfa169235929a0dafa3287c1f6f6b82d4ee53f83a8a4a8564438097c92e4eeba:0

value
129364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25fef25397d63e266a2a3a334a5e22d7df39501 OP_EQUAL
address
3HxB8K3mL7Z8eDfp5dBrTYVEivJWcM1LYW
transaction
dfa169235929a0dafa3287c1f6f6b82d4ee53f83a8a4a8564438097c92e4eeba
confirmations
285299
spent
true